How to read this view

Scale, momentum, and access belong in the same frame.

Trade value identifies the routes with the largest observed footprint. Growth shows how that footprint has changed over the available three-year comparison. Share indicates the route's position within the displayed product view.

Distance, FTA status, volatility, and signals add context from supporting bilateral datasets. Missing values are not filled or treated as zero.
